  To choose a good climbing shoe, there are three main aspects: shoe upper, lining, and sole.

  1. Shoe upper

  Vamp material is not pure leather fabric, leather fabric, textile fabric mix, and hard plastic resin fabric.

  Mixed leather and textile fabrics

  Advantages: light weight, good air permeability, wearing more flexible and convenient, textile fabrics cost much lower than leather fabrics.

  Disadvantages: textile fabrics waterproof performance is poor, service life is not as good as leather, soft texture, foot protection is not as good as leather.

  Pure leather fabric

  Advantages: good waterproof performance, high wear resistance, better protection to the foot, and better textile fabric.

  Disadvantages: its own weight is heavier than textile fabrics, air permeability is not as good as textile fabrics, wearing shoes more time-consuming.

  Hard plastic resin

  Advantages: Harder, with better rigidity, can effectively protect the foot safety, alpine climbing boots are made of this resin material.

  Disadvantages: large volume, heavy load, heavy wear and tear, heavy and time-consuming.

  2. Lining

  The main role of the lining is waterproof, breathable, these two directly related to your foot when you wear climbing shoes happiness index, if the upper is craftsmanship water products, lining is a spelling technology materials. If you dont want to wet your socks or fill your shoes with water on a rainy day without going through a puddle, its recommended that you choose shoes with these two technology fabrics: GORE-TEX and eVENT, both of which are the worlds top waterproof and breathable fabrics.

  3.Big bottom

  The sole should be considered durable and whether it has skid resistance is mainly based on its material selection and texture design. The best choice is V bottom. What is the bottom of V, that is, the use of Vibram rubber sole. Vibram rubber was made in Italy, and people began to make rubber tires for aircraft in 1947. Later, they found it easier and more affordable to make soles, so they ran to get rubber to make soles, and became the worlds first sole supplier. Identify whether your shoes have a Vibram sole. Just look at the sole and see if there is a yellow LOGO rubber with Vibram on it.
